Course structure

• Foundations of Conflict Resolution and Art Therapy
• Art-Based Interventions for Emotional Regulation
• Communication Skills and Creative Expression in Conflict Resolution
• Trauma-Informed Art Therapy Practices
• Group Dynamics and Collaborative Art Projects
• Cultural Sensitivity and Diversity in Art Therapy
• Ethical Considerations in Conflict Resolution and Art Therapy
• Case Studies and Practical Applications of Art Therapy in Conflict Resolution
• Self-Care and Resilience Building for Practitioners
• Integrating Art Therapy into Mediation and Negotiation Processes

The Certificate Programme in Conflict Resolution through Art Therapy is increasingly significant in today’s market, particularly in the UK, where mental health and workplace conflict resolution are critical concerns. According to recent data, 74% of UK employees have experienced conflict at work, with 29% reporting it as a regular occurrence. Additionally, 1 in 6 UK adults experiences a mental health issue weekly, highlighting the need for innovative therapeutic approaches like art therapy. This programme equips learners with the skills to address these challenges, blending conflict resolution techniques with the therapeutic power of art.
